What is a Built-In Microwave Oven?
A built-in microwave oven is developed to be set up straight into cooking area cabinets or walls, instead of being a freestanding appliance. This style gets rid of counter top mess and develops a streamlined appearance in the kitchen design. Built-in microwaves frequently include specialized functions that improve cooking flexibility and effectiveness.

Considerations When Choosing a Built-In Microwave1. Size and Fit
Step the area where you plan to set up the built-in microwave to guarantee it fits properly. Think about both the width and height, as well as depth, considering that some designs may need additional area for ventilation.
2. Power and Efficiency
Try to find designs with enough wattage (usually in between 900 to 1200 watts) to ensure quick cooking times. In addition, think about energy-efficient designs that can assist conserve on electrical power expenses.
3. Relieve of Use
Select a microwave with an instinctive control panel and easy-to-read display screen. Features such as preset cooking modes and sensing unit technology can simplify cooking jobs.
4. Installation Type
Choose whether you choose a built-in microwave that sits above your oven (over-the-range) or one that is placed within the cabinets (in-wall). Each type has its advantages and drawbacks.
5. Brand and Warranty
Research reputable manufacturers and think about service warranty options. A great warranty can provide assurance regarding repair work and maintenance.
6. Rate Range
Built-in microwaves can differ substantially in cost depending upon features and brand. Set a spending plan based upon your requirements and preferences.

What is the average life expectancy of a built-in microwave?
A normal built-in microwave can last between 9 to ten years, depending on use and maintenance.
2. Can built-in microwaves be set up in cabinets?
Yes, built-in microwaves are specifically developed for setup within cooking area cabinetry, but it’s vital to follow the maker’s setup standards.
3. Are built-in microwaves more costly than countertop designs?
Normally, built-in microwaves are more costly due to their design and installation requirements. However, the cost can vary based on features and brands.
4. Can I replace a built-in microwave myself?
While some house owners might feel comfortable replacing a built-in microwave, it’s advised to employ an expert to ensure proper installation and compliance with safety requirements.
5. Do built-in microwaves require venting?
It depends upon the model. Some built-in microwaves included built-in ventilation, while others may require external venting. Speak with the manufacturer’s requirements for assistance.
